Don Catanzaro (dgc@cast.uark.edu) writes on 25 Mar 94:

I seem to remember some talk a while back about creating some grass
programs that would calculate semi-variagrams...Does anyone know about the
progress ??

unfortunately, there's not been much progress. I was doing it
just for funzies (started as an independent study project), but
now that I'm contemplating graduation...

Some of the basic functions are finished but the interface (Vask)
stinks. It's on pasture.ecn.purdue.edu:pub/mccauley/grass and requires
g.gnuplot (for plotting, dartmouth.edu). Anyone is welcome to
finish it if they want - it may be a while before I can get back
to it (just let me know so that nothing is duplicated).

In a related matter, someone else has started taking a look at
the kriging code originally done by Chris Skelley.
